For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public preschool serving 248 students in Branch Independent School District. This district's average pre testing ranking is 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public pre schools in Michigan.
Public Preschool in Branch Independent School District have an average math proficiency score of 17% (versus the Michigan public pre school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 37% (versus the 40%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 14%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Michigan public preschool average of 41% (majority Black).
